If you’d like to vote in the primaries coming up on June 3, the deadline is today. From the San Diego County Registrar of Voters:
The following locations will be open until midnight on May 19.
Registrar of Voters Office
5201 Ruffin Road, Suite I
San Diego, CA 92123City of Escondido – Council Chambers
201 North Broadway
Escondido, CA 92025
Party affiliation doesn’t matter for local elections. Unaffiliated voters can vote in either the Republican, Democratic, or American Independent primaries for state or national offices
